I learned thru my grapevine that a match is scheduled between Lori Jon Jones and Mike Siegal.
Place: Las Vegas
Date: 8/21/05
Game: 8 Ball. Race to 9 in each set, best of three sets
Prize money: Winner gets One Hundred Thousand US $ and the runner up
gets Fifty Thousand US $
Wait for the other details till an official anouncement comes.
Hope my grapevine did not give me false information.Cheers

Somebody or a group of somebodies thinks putting up $150,000 for this match may be a good thing, kind of the battle of the sexes between two Billiard Congress of America Hall of Famers. Great deal for both players, though!

Best two out of three sets of 8-ball will be an interesting format. Since the majority of pool-playing folk in the States do play 8-ball, it may generate some interest as it relates to pocket billiards on TV. This morning, I visited the ESPN site, and I kept hitting links and searching for "pool" and "billiards," but came up empty, with the exception of one article written about the hottest chicks in sports. They had a very complimentary snippet about Jennifer Baretta AND a link to an ESPN radio interview. I did not see one mention of any international or national pocket billiards competition events.

I hope this isn't an urban legend, and I will look forward to seeing this, if and when it unfolds. :)
